What is a Biodata for Marriage?

A marriage biodata is a document that summarises an individual's personal and professional life to help find a compatible life partner. Often compared to a resume or CV for marriage purposes, it is the first step in the matchmaking process - particularly in cultures where arranged marriages are common, such as Hindu, Muslim, Sikh, Jain, and Christian communities. A well-prepared matrimonial biodata - also called a biodata for a wedding or biodata for shadi - helps individuals introduce themselves clearly to potential partners and their families.

A marriage biodata - also called a matrimonial biodata or biodata for marriage - typically includes the following information:

  • Personal Details: Full name, date of birth, age, height, religion, caste or community, and city of residence. Community-specific fields like gotra, nakshatra, or rashi are added here by Hindu families.
  • Family Background: Father and mother with their names and occupations, siblings with marital status, native place, and whether the family is joint or nuclear. This is the section families typically read first.
  • Educational Qualifications: Highest degree, name of the institution, and year of passing. If you hold a postgraduate degree, list both degrees.
  • Professional Information: Current job title, employer name, city, and income range. For business owners, describe the nature and location of the business.
  • Lifestyle and Interests: Hobbies, languages spoken, and any relevant personal details that help convey personality beyond qualifications.
  • Partner Preferences: Two to three sentences on the age range, location, education, and values you are looking for in a life partner. Write naturally - not as a checklist.

Marriage Biodata Format for Boy and Girl

The structure of a marriage biodata is the same for everyone - the standard sections of personal details, family, education, profession, partner expectations, and contact do not change. What changes is the emphasis, and a few details families expect to see.

Marriage Biodata Format for Boy

In a boy's biodata, families read the profession block most carefully - job title, employer or business, work city, and income range. State the income as a range rather than leaving it blank; a missing income line raises more questions than a modest one. If the family runs a business, add one line about its nature and who manages it. See the marriage biodata format for boy page for templates and a filled example.

Marriage Biodata Format for Girl

In a girl's biodata, education and family background usually get the closest reading - degree, institution, and the family's values and native place. Working professionals should state their career plainly, including whether they plan to continue working. See the marriage biodata format for girl page for templates and examples.

Marriage Biodata Photo and Design Tips

A biodata is judged in the first few seconds - before anyone reads a word. These small choices decide that first impression:

  • Photograph: Use a recent, clear photo with a plain background - shoulders up or three-quarter length, in formal or traditional dress. Avoid group photos, sunglasses, and heavy filters.
  • With or without photo: The photo is optional. Many families prefer to share the photograph separately on WhatsApp after the first conversation - leave the photo field empty and the layout adjusts automatically.
  • God image and background: Choose the god image your family uses - Ganesha and Om for Hindu biodatas, Bismillah for Muslim biodatas - or a plain border design if you prefer a neutral look. The background should stay light so the text remains readable on print.
  • Keep it to one page: A biodata that runs to a second page rarely gets read. If yours overflows, trim hobbies and shorten the partner expectations - never the family or contact details.
  • Consistent details: Make sure the age matches the date of birth, and the income range matches what the family will say on the phone. Mismatches are the most common reason a rishta conversation stalls early.

Marriage Biodata Formats - By Community and Type

Every community presents the same six sections with its own customary fields. Hindu marriage biodatas add gotra, rashi, nakshatra, and often manglik status under personal details. Muslim marriage biodatas mention sect and maslak, and usually replace the god image with Bismillah. Marathi and Gujarati families add the native village and the family business type.
